Review of “I Had to Say Something” by Mike Jones
“I Had to Say Something” by Mike Jones is the story of a Denver based male Escort who over the course of 3 years had a client-provider relationship with “Art”, a man who turned out to be Ted Haggard, an influential evangelical preacher who railed against homosexuality while at the same time exploring his own private homosexual inclinations. Ted Haggard also used Methamphetamine while in session with Mike to enhance his sexual experience. Mike Jones exposed Ted Haggard as a hypocrite and as a result Ted Haggard lost his position and influence and Mike Jones was no longer able to work as an escort.
As a male escort myself, I could not help but ask myself what I would do if I were in Mike’s position. When Mike went public with his story, he broke an unspoken code of silence that is traditionally expected in a client-provider relationship. In most cases neither party wishes to identify as an escort or a client of escorts but Mike Jones was faced with a crisis of conscience and its clear from reading the book that he acted with his heart, and chose to break his silence because he believed it to be right thing to do from a moral position. In his own words “ he was compelled to come forward because he believes Haggard, an opponent of same-sex marriage, is being hypocritical”. It could be said that he enjoyed the celebrity that came after his story broke, and profited from it with a major book deal but he was not an opportunist. One cannot help but feel for him as he recounts his story of coming forward and having to deal with the overwhelming backlash. Mike defends his controversial decision to tell his story “This was unique ... someone who is spewing hatred; who’s spewing discrimination; who’s touching millions of people's lives by his verbal content…It couldn’t continue… I had to do it.”
While it’s clear Mike acted with his heart, after reading the book its still difficult to say whether his actions were ethical. I feel that Ted Haggard and any client of an escort are entitled the same client-provider confidentiality that a doctor, psychologist or even a pastor would offer. In traditional client-provider relationships unless subpoenaed, the provider is not obligated to go public with anything that is said or done in private session unless that person is a danger to society. One might argue that Ted Haggard was a danger to society, and in a way that could be true, however he was not plotting a dangerous act that could cause bodily harm or death to anyone.
So now Ted’s big secret is out and the damage is done. Many now view Mike Jones as a hero for exposing this hypocrite, but perhaps the next escort who writes a tell-all will consider outing themselves and not their clients. From the way Ted is described in the book he actually sounds like a good albeit unremarkable client.
